Source code for core.abc.food_source
"""The FoodSources representing positions on the optimization surface
used by the ABC optimizer as desribed in [1]. Can be considered the
*memory units* for Employee and Onlooker Bees
[1] Karaboga, D., & Basturk, B. (2007). A powerful and efficient
algorithm for numerical function optimization: artificial bee
colony (ABC) algorithm. Journal of global optimization, 39(3),
459-471.
"""
[docs]class FoodSource(object):
'''The FoodSource class encapsulates the position on the optimization surface and its
corresponding fitness value + the evaluation time taken (in seconds)
Attributes:
eval_time (float): the time taken to evaluate the given position (in seconds)
pos (str): the string-encoded position on the optimization surface
fit (float): the fitness corresponding the stored position
'''
def __init__(self, position=None, fitness=None):
'''
Data structure containing a FoodSource (position on the
optimization surface) and its fitness value
Args:
position (str, optional): the string-encoded position on the optimization surface
fitness (float, optional): the fitness corresponding the stored position
'''
self.pos = position
self.fit = fitness
self.eval_time = 0.0
[docs] def encode_position(self):
'''Returns an encoded position for use in dicts
Returns:
str: a formatted, whitespace-stripped version of the stored position. \
Used as the "candidate" in the stored CSV
'''
return str(self.pos).replace(' ', '')
